At age 22, she took up swimming to counter for the harmful effects of tobacco and quit smoking when she found her true passion: triathlon.
She has participated in three of the ten toughest races in the world, as classified by National Geographic: the Marathon des Sables,[2] Badwater[3] and Furnace Creek 508, now called Silver State 508.
[4] Toti was the second placed woman and twelfth overall at the Death Valley Cup,[5] a double race consisting of Badwater and Furnace Creek 508 during the same calendar year.
She is the author of the autobiographic book "210,000 kilómetros" (130,000 Miles), in which she narrates her own experience in three of top ten toughest competitions in the world according to National Geographic,[6] sharing with the reader not only her sports career but also the most difficult moments and challenges of her personal life.
Presently, Toti gives talks and lectures on leadership, teamwork, motivation, crisis and conflict management, planning and strategy, change, and facing our fears.
